Overview
RabbitMQ carries the events between your services: an order accepted, a payment failed, a job finished. Support answers questions about those events without being able to see them. A consumer that reads the queues worth watching and posts to the Tidio API closes that gap, and a request confirmed in a conversation can be published back for the service that owns it. RabbitMQ stays the transport, with its acknowledgments intact.

How it works
Connect RabbitMQ in minutes
1
Connect RabbitMQ and Tidio
A consumer reads the queues you choose and posts to the Tidio API, or a webhook bridge carries events.
2
Pick the queues
Bind a dedicated consumer to the events support needs, so nothing else is read.
3
Keep delivery safe
Acknowledge properly and use a dead letter queue, so a chat integration never loses a message.
